#include <stdio.h>
void prime(int n)
{
int i=0;
int j=0;
int k;
int arr[99999]={0};
for(i=1;i<n;i++)
arr[i]=i+1;
for(i=1;i<n;i++)
{
for(j=2;j*j<=n;)
{
if(arr[i]%j==0)
arr[i]=0;
while(1){
if(arr[k]!=0)
{
j=k+1;
break;
}
k++;
}
k++;
}
}
}
int main(void) {
prime(20);
return 0;
}
I2luY2x1ZGUgPHN0ZGlvLmg+Cgp2b2lkIHByaW1lKGludCBuKQp7CglpbnQgaT0wOwoJaW50IGo9MDsKCWludCBrOwoJaW50IGFycls5OTk5OV09ezB9OwoJZm9yKGk9MTtpPG47aSsrKQoJCWFycltpXT1pKzE7CglwcmludGYoIiUzZCIsMik7Cglmb3IoaT0xO2k8bjtpKyspCgl7CgkJZm9yKGo9MjtqKmo8PW47KQoJCXsKCQlpZihhcnJbaV0laj09MCkKCQkJYXJyW2ldPTA7CgkJd2hpbGUoMSl7CgkJCWlmKGFycltrXSE9MCkKCQkJewoJCQkJaj1rKzE7CgkJCQlwcmludGYoIiUzZCIsaysxKTsKCQkJCWJyZWFrOwoJCQl9CgkJCWsrKzsKCQl9CgkJaysrOwoJfQoJfQp9CgppbnQgbWFpbih2b2lkKSB7CglwcmltZSgyMCk7CglyZXR1cm4gMDsKfQ==